p,a,div,textarea{font-family: Arial, Helvetica, sans-serif;}
._container{
position:relative;display:inline-block;width:100%;color: inherit;text-align:left;clear:both;margin:0 auto;
}
._div{
vertical-align:top;display:inline-block;position:relative;color: inherit;float:left;
}
.Image_Index{
 position: relative; opacity:0.4; bottom: 250px; 
}
.Image_Index:hover{
opacity:1;
}
.Image{
position:relative;vertical-align:top;display: inline-block;float:left;
}
._container1{
position: relative;display: inline-block;width:100%;clear:both;color: inherit;text-align: center;margin: 0 auto;
}
.results{
position:relative;display:inline-block;width:100%;text-align:left;margin:0 auto;
}
._mdiv{
vertical-align:top;position: relative;color: inherit;text-align: center;display: inline-block;
}
._div1{
  background-color:#E8E8E8 ;margin: 3px;display: inline-block; vertical-align:top;
}
._rdiv{
vertical-align:top;position: relative;color: inherit;text-align: right;display: inline-block;
}
.Welcome{
font: 200 40px 'Great Vibes', Helvetica, sans-serif;  color: white;  text-shadow: 4px 4px 3px rgba(0,0,0,0.1); 
}
._fixed{
position: fixed;right:0;top:30%;   background:white ;
}
.Error{
font-weight: bold;color:red;
}
._box{
  width:30px; height:30px; text-align:center; font-size:20px;
}
._ebox{
  width:30px; height:30px; text-align:center;background-color:grey;
}
.float{
     color: black;    position:fixed;    border:3px solid 66CCFF;    top:50%;    left:50%;    background-color: white;    box-shadow: 10px 10px 5px grey;
}
._head_text{
color:white;
}
.test_button{
  background: #C8C8C8;   background: -webkit-gradient(linear, left top, left bottom, from(#ffffff), to(#caf700));   background: -webkit-linear-gradient(top, #B8B8B8, #E0E0E0);   background: -moz-linear-gradient(top, #B8B8B8, #E0E0E0);   background: -ms-linear-gradient(top, #B8B8B8, #E0E0E0);   background: -o-linear-gradient(top, #B8B8B8, #E0E0E0);   -webkit-border-radius: 6px;   -moz-border-radius: 6px;   border-radius: 6px;   -webkit-box-shadow: rgba(0,0,0,1) 0 1px 0;   -moz-box-shadow: rgba(0,0,0,1) 0 1px 0;   box-shadow: rgba(0,0,0,1) 0 1px 0;   text-shadow: rgba(0,0,0,.3) 0 1px 0;   font-family:arial;font-size: 18pt; border:1px solid #18ab29;  text-decoration: none;   vertical-align: middle;   cursor:pointer;
}
.test_button:hover{
  background: blue;   color: white;
}
._FlashNew{
position: relative;display: inline-block;color:white;font-size:inherit;
}
.Image_Div{
    position: absolute;    bottom: 100px; width:100%;text-align: center;
}
.Head{
	width:100%;
	color:white;
	background:#4F19FF;
	background:-moz-linear-gradient(285deg,rgb(79,25,255) 0%,rgb(255,56,135) 50%);
	background:-webkit-linear-gradient(285deg,rgb(79,25,255) 0%,rgb(255,56,135) 50%);
	background:-o-linear-gradient(285deg,rgb(79,25,255) 0%,rgb(255,56,135) 50%);
	background:-ms-linear-gradient(285deg,rgb(79,25,255) 0%,rgb(255,56,135) 50%);
	background:linear-gradient(285deg,rgb(79,25,255) 0%,rgb(255,56,135) 50%);
	
}
.Menu{
	background-color:black;
	color:white;
	min-height:30px;
	
}
.LMenu{
	vertical-align:top;
	display:inline-block;
	float:left;
	min-height:300px;
	text-align:left;
	background-color:#C0C0C0;
	
}
.Title{
	font-size:150%;
	text-align:center;
	background-color:#585858;
	float:center;
	color:white;
	
}
.Image{
	position:relative;
	vertical-align:top;
	display:inline-block;
	float:left;
	
}
.News{
	vertical-align:top;
	display:inline-block;
	float:right;
	
}
.Home{
	position:relative;
	vertical-align:top;
	display:inline-block;
	float:left;
	clear:both;
	width:100%;
	
}
.Slogan{
	font-size:100%;
	color:inherit;
	
}
.State{
	background:#D8D8D8;
	clear:both;
	width:100%;
	font-size:80%;
	text-align:center;
	color:#8c8c8c;
	margin:0 auto;
	
}
.Links{
	position:relative;
	vertical-align:top;
	display:inline-block;
	float:left;
	clear:both;
	width:100%;
	
}
.Sponsor{
	position:relative;
	vertical-align:top;
	display:inline-block;
	float:left;
	clear:both;
	width:100%;
	
}
.Form{
	display:inline-block;
	background-color:#d1d1d1;
	border:2px solid #848484;
	border-radius:6px;
	box-shadow:0px 0px 6px #000000;
	margin:0 auto;
	
}
.School{
	font-size:200%;
	text-align:center;
	float:center;
	color:white;
	
}
input[type=button]{
	position:relative;
	background:#C8C8C8;
	background:-webkit-gradient(linear, left top, left bottom, from(#ffffff), to(#caf700));
	background:-webkit-linear-gradient(top, #B8B8B8, #E0E0E0);
	background:-moz-linear-gradient(top, #B8B8B8, #E0E0E0);
	background:-ms-linear-gradient(top, #B8B8B8, #E0E0E0);
	background:-o-linear-gradient(top, #B8B8B8, #E0E0E0);
	-webkit-border-radius:4px;
	-moz-border-radius:4px;
	border-radius:4px;
	-webkit-box-shadow:rgba(0,0,0,1) 0 1px 0;
	-moz-box-shadow:rgba(0,0,0,1) 0 1px 0;
	box-shadow:rgba(0,0,0,1) 0 1px 0;
	text-shadow:rgba(0,0,0,.3) 0 1px 0;
	text-decoration:none;
	vertical-align:middle;
	
}
input[type=button]:hover{
	background: blue;
	color: white;
	cursor:pointer;
	
}
input[type=button]:active{
	border-top-color: #1b435e;
	
}
.Button{
	position:relative;
	//   padding:2px 2px;
	border-style:solid;
	background:#ccccb3;
	color:white;
	
}
.Button:hover{
	border-top-color: blue;
	 background: blue;
	 cursor:pointer;
	 color: blue;
	
}
.Button:active{
	border-top-color: #1b435e;
	 background: #1b435e;
	
}
.Index{
	vertical-align:top;
	display:inline-block;
	float:left;
	text-align:left;
	background-color:#C0C0C0;
	
}
.h{
	background-color:#B0B0B0;
	font-weight:bold;
	
}
.r1{
	background-color:#F0F0F0;
	
}
.r2{
	background-color:#E0F5FF;
	
}
.Editor{
	background-color:white;
	border-style:solid;
	border-width:1px;
	color:black;
	overflow:scroll;
	overflow-x:scroll;
	
}
.a{
	color:black;
	
}
.a:hover{
	color:blue;
	
}
._container{
	position:relative;
	display:inline-block;
	width:100%;
	text-align:left;
	clear:both;
	margin:0 auto;
	
}
._div{
	vertical-align:top;
	display:inline-block;
	position:relative;
	float:left;
	
}
.Image_Index{
	position: relative;
	 opacity:0.4;
	 bottom: 250px;
	
}
.Image_Index:hover{
	opacity:1;
	
}
.Image_Text{
	color:F7FFFD;
	text-align:center;
	background-color:blue;
	font-size:200%;
	border-radius:25px;
	opacity:0.77;
	padding:15px 15px 15px 15px;
	
}
._container1{
	position: relative;
	display: inline-block;
	width:100%;
	clear:both;
	text-align: center;
	margin: 0 auto;
	
}
.results{
	position:relative;
	display:inline-block;
	width:100%;
	text-align:left;
	margin:0 auto;
	
}
._mdiv{
	vertical-align:top;
	position: relative;
	text-align: center;
	display: inline-block;
	
}
._div1{
	background-color:#E8E8E8 ;
	margin: 3px;
	display: inline-block;
	 vertical-align:top;
	
}
._rdiv{
	vertical-align:top;
	position: relative;
	text-align: right;
	display: inline-block;
	
}
.Welcome{
	font: 200 40px "Great Vibes", Helvetica, sans-serif;
	 color: white;
	 text-shadow: 4px 4px 3px rgba(0,0,0,0.1);
	
}
._fixed{
	position: fixed;
	right:0;
	top:30%;
	 background:white ;
	
}
.Error{
	font-weight: bold;
	color:red;
	
}
._box{
	width:30px;
	 height:30px;
	 text-align:center;
	 font-size:20px;
	
}
._ebox{
	width:30px;
	 height:30px;
	 text-align:center;
	background-color:grey;
	
}
.float{
	color: black;
	 position:fixed;
	 border:3px solid 66CCFF;
	 top:50%;
	 left:50%;
	 background-color: white;
	 box-shadow: 10px 10px 5px grey;
	
}
._head_text{
	color:white;
	
}
.test_button{
	background: #C8C8C8;
	 background: -webkit-gradient(linear, left top, left bottom, from(#ffffff), to(#caf700));
	 background: -webkit-linear-gradient(top, #B8B8B8, #E0E0E0);
	 background: -moz-linear-gradient(top, #B8B8B8, #E0E0E0);
	 background: -ms-linear-gradient(top, #B8B8B8, #E0E0E0);
	 background: -o-linear-gradient(top, #B8B8B8, #E0E0E0);
	 -webkit-border-radius: 6px;
	 -moz-border-radius: 6px;
	 border-radius: 6px;
	 -webkit-box-shadow: rgba(0,0,0,1) 0 1px 0;
	 -moz-box-shadow: rgba(0,0,0,1) 0 1px 0;
	 box-shadow: rgba(0,0,0,1) 0 1px 0;
	 text-shadow: rgba(0,0,0,.3) 0 1px 0;
	 font-family:arial;
	font-size: 18pt;
	 border:1px solid #18ab29;
	 text-decoration: none;
	 vertical-align: middle;
	 cursor:pointer;
	
}
.test_button:hover{
	background: blue;
	 color: white;
	
}
.ExtraDiv{
	vertical-align:top;
	display:inline-block;
	float:right;
	text-align:left;
	min-height:300px;
	max-width:100px;
	background-color:#C0C0C0;
	
}
.Template{
	1
}
.MenuList{
	position:relative;
	display:inline-block;
	background:inherit;
	width:80%;
	color:inherit;
	clear:both;
	text-align:center;
	margin:0 auto;
	
}
.Q{
	width:100%;
	
}
.Flash{
	width:100%;
	font-size:120%;
	font-weight: bold;
	color:white;
	   background:blue;
	overflow:hidden;
	white-space: nowrap;
	
}
